Pati weather in July

In July, Pati sees average daytime highs of 30°C and overnight lows near 23°C, with 44 mm of rain across 8.4 wet days and about 11.6 hours of daylight. It is the 7th-warmest and 10th-wettest month of the year here.

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 30°C through the month.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 36% of the time in July, and the air most often feels oppressive.

Daylight stretches from about 11 h 36 min at the start of July to 11 h 42 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, July is Pati's 2nd-clearest and 5th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Pati's year-round climate.

A typical July day in Pati reaches about 30°C in the afternoon and slips back to 23°C overnight — a 7°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 29°C and 31°C. Set against its neighbours, July runs on par with June and on par with August.

Location & terrain

Where is Pati?

Pati sits at 6.8°S, 111.0°E, 13 m above sea level, in Indonesia. The nearest listed city is Juwana, 13 km away.

Topography around Pati

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Pati.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Pati has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 31 m around an average of 12 m above sea level; within 16 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 628 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,562 m.

The land around Pati is covered by cropland (41%) and artificial surfaces (39%) within 3 km, cropland (45%) and trees (34%) within 16 km, and water (38%), trees (33%) and cropland (22%) within 80 km.
